The Importance of Chimneys in Buildings

Chimneys are essential components of a building's ventilation system, serving the critical purpose of expelling harmful gases produced during the combustion process. These gases, such as carbon monoxide and sulfur dioxide, can be hazardous to human health if not properly vented. Additionally, chimneys remove excess heat and prevent the buildup of smoke and soot inside the living space.

Apart from ensuring the safety and well-being of occupants, chimneys also play a role in energy efficiency. By effectively channeling gases and heat out of the building, chimneys help maintain a comfortable indoor environment while reducing the strain on heating appliances.

Masonry Chimneys

Masonry chimneys are one of the most common types of chimneys found in residential and commercial buildings. These chimneys are constructed using bricks, stones, or concrete blocks and are built on-site by skilled masons. Let's take a closer look at the construction and materials used, as well as the advantages and disadvantages of masonry chimneys.

Construction and Materials

Masonry chimneys are built by stacking bricks, stones, or concrete blocks in a specific pattern to create a sturdy and durable structure. Mortar is used to bind the materials together, providing strength and stability to the chimney. The construction process involves careful planning and precise execution to ensure a safe and efficient chimney system.

The materials used in masonry chimneys offer excellent resistance to high temperatures, making them suitable for containing and channeling smoke and gases produced by the fireplace or heating appliance. The bricks, stones, or concrete blocks used in the construction provide insulation, preventing heat from transferring to the surrounding walls and structures.

Advantages and Disadvantages

Masonry chimneys offer several advantages that make them a popular choice for many homeowners. Some of the key advantages include:

  • Durability: Masonry chimneys are known for their long lifespan and resistance to weather conditions, making them a reliable option for years to come.
  • Aesthetics: The natural beauty and charm of brick or stone chimneys can enhance the overall appearance of a building, adding a touch of elegance and character.
  • Insulation: The materials used in masonry chimneys provide insulation, reducing heat loss and improving the energy efficiency of the building.
  • Customization: With masonry chimneys, there is flexibility in design and customization options. Different patterns, textures, and finishes can be achieved to match the architectural style of the building.

However, there are a few considerations and disadvantages associated with masonry chimneys, including:

  • Cost: The construction of masonry chimneys can be more expensive compared to other types of chimneys due to the materials and labor involved.
  • Installation Time: The construction process for masonry chimneys takes longer compared to prefabricated or metal chimneys, as it requires skilled labor and attention to detail.
  • Maintenance: Regular maintenance is necessary to ensure the longevity of masonry chimneys. Over time, mortar may deteriorate and require repair or repointing to maintain structural integrity.

Prefabricated or Factory-Built Chimneys

Prefabricated or factory-built chimneys are an increasingly popular choice for homeowners due to their convenience and ease of installation. These chimneys are manufactured off-site in a factory and then transported to the desired location for installation. Let's take a closer look at the construction, materials, as well as the advantages and disadvantages of prefabricated or factory-built chimneys.

Construction and Materials

Prefabricated chimneys are constructed using a range of materials, including stainless steel, galvanized steel, aluminum, or a combination of these materials. The chimney components are typically designed to fit together seamlessly, allowing for a straightforward and efficient installation process.

These chimneys consist of sections or modules that are assembled on-site. The sections are usually connected using locking mechanisms or clamps, ensuring a secure and stable structure. Additionally, prefabricated chimneys often come with insulation layers to enhance their efficiency and safety.

Advantages and Disadvantages

Advantages

  1. Ease of Installation: Prefabricated chimneys are designed for quick and hassle-free installation. They come with clear instructions and can be assembled by professionals or experienced DIY enthusiasts.
  2. Cost-Effective: Compared to masonry chimneys, prefabricated chimneys are generally more affordable. The streamlined manufacturing process allows for cost savings that are often passed on to the consumer.
  3. Versatility: These chimneys are available in various sizes and configurations, making them suitable for a wide range of applications and building types.
  4. Efficient Performance: Prefabricated chimneys are engineered to meet safety and performance standards. They often feature insulation layers that minimize heat loss and improve overall energy efficiency.

Disadvantages

  1. Limited Customization: Unlike masonry chimneys, prefabricated chimneys offer limited customization options in terms of design and aesthetics. They are typically available in standardized designs.
  2. Durability: While prefabricated chimneys are built to last, they may not have the same lifespan as masonry chimneys. The materials used, such as stainless steel or galvanized steel, may be more susceptible to corrosion over time.
  3. Maintenance and Repairs: If a component of a prefabricated chimney becomes damaged, it may need to be replaced entirely, rather than repaired. This can incur additional costs compared to repairing individual sections of a masonry chimney.

Metal Chimneys

Metal chimneys are a popular choice for many homeowners due to their durability, versatility, and ease of installation. They are constructed using various types of metals, each with its own set of advantages and disadvantages. In this section, we will explore the construction and materials used in metal chimneys, as well as their advantages and disadvantages.

Construction and Materials

Metal chimneys are typically constructed using materials such as stainless steel, galvanized steel, or aluminum. These metals are chosen for their ability to withstand high temperatures and resist corrosion.

The construction of metal chimneys involves assembling prefabricated sections or pipes that are connected together to form a complete chimney system. These sections are designed to fit securely, with joints sealed to prevent leaks and ensure proper ventilation.

Metal chimneys often feature insulation layers to help retain heat and improve energy efficiency. This insulation helps prevent excessive heat transfer to surrounding structures and minimizes the risk of fire hazards.

Advantages and Disadvantages

Metal chimneys offer several advantages that make them a popular choice among homeowners:

Advantages:

  1. Durability: Metal chimneys are highly durable and can withstand extreme weather conditions, making them suitable for both indoor and outdoor installations.
  2. Versatility: Metal chimneys can be used with various fuel types, including wood, gas, and oil. This versatility allows homeowners to choose the appropriate fuel option for their needs.
  3. Ease of Installation: Metal chimneys are relatively easy to install compared to other chimney types. The prefabricated sections and pipes simplify the installation process, saving time and effort.
  4. Cost-Effective: Metal chimneys are often more cost-effective than other chimney types. The materials used in their construction are generally less expensive, making them a budget-friendly option for homeowners.
  5. Low Maintenance: Metal chimneys require minimal maintenance. Regular inspections and occasional cleaning are usually sufficient to keep them in good working condition.

Despite their advantages, metal chimneys also have a few disadvantages to consider:

Disadvantages:

  1. Heat Transfer: Metal chimneys can transfer heat to the surrounding areas. This can be a concern for combustible materials in close proximity to the chimney.
  2. Noise Transmission: Metal chimneys may transmit noise more easily compared to other chimney types. This can be a factor to consider if noise reduction is important in your living space.
  3. Limited Aesthetic Options: Metal chimneys may have a more industrial or utilitarian appearance compared to masonry or other chimney types. This may not suit every architectural style or personal preference.

Gas Chimneys

Gas chimneys are a popular choice for many homeowners due to their convenience and efficiency. These chimneys are specifically designed to vent gas-burning appliances, such as gas fireplaces, furnaces, and water heaters. Let's take a closer look at the construction and materials of gas chimneys, as well as their advantages and disadvantages.

Construction and Materials

Gas chimneys consist of a flue pipe that carries the combustion gases from the gas-burning appliance to the outside of the building. The flue pipe is typically made of stainless steel or aluminum, which are both corrosion-resistant materials. These materials ensure the durability and longevity of the chimney, even when exposed to the byproducts of gas combustion.

In addition to the flue pipe, gas chimneys also include a termination cap or chimney cap at the top. This cap helps to prevent debris, rain, and animals from entering the chimney while still allowing the gases to vent safely.

Advantages and Disadvantages

Gas chimneys offer several advantages that make them a popular choice for homeowners:

Advantages

Efficient and effective venting of gas-burning appliances

Easy installation and low maintenance

Versatility in design and placement

No need for a traditional masonry chimney

Can be used in a variety of building types, including homes and commercial buildings

However, it's important to consider the potential disadvantages of gas chimneys as well:

Disadvantages

Reliance on a gas supply for operation

Limited to venting gas-burning appliances only

May require professional installation to ensure proper venting

Regular inspections and maintenance are necessary to ensure safe operation

Gas chimneys provide an efficient and convenient solution for venting gas-burning appliances. However, it's essential to follow proper installation guidelines and conduct regular inspections to ensure the safety and functionality of the chimney.

Electric Chimneys

Electric chimneys are a modern and convenient alternative to traditional chimneys. They operate using electricity and offer several benefits for homeowners. In this section, we will explore the construction and materials used in electric chimneys, as well as their advantages and disadvantages.

Construction and Materials

Electric chimneys are typically constructed using a combination of metal, glass, and heat-resistant materials. The main components of an electric chimney include:

  1. Firebox: The firebox of an electric chimney is where the simulated flames are produced. It is usually made of heat-resistant materials such as tempered glass or ceramic.
  2. Heating Element: Electric chimneys feature a heating element that generates heat to mimic the appearance of real flames. The heating element is often made of coiled metal wires that produce a warm glow when activated.
  3. Fan and Blower: Electric chimneys are equipped with a fan or blower that helps circulate the heat generated by the heating element. This allows for efficient heating of the surrounding area.
  4. Controls: Electric chimneys come with control panels that allow users to adjust the flame intensity, heat output, and other settings. These controls are typically located on the front of the chimney for easy access.

Advantages and Disadvantages

Electric chimneys offer several advantages that make them a popular choice among homeowners. Here are some of the key benefits:

Advantages

Easy installation without the need for a traditional chimney structure

Convenient operation with adjustable heat settings and flame intensity

No emissions or pollutants, making them environmentally friendly

Safe to use, as there is no real flame or combustion involved

Versatility, as they can be installed in various locations and easily moved if needed

Despite their advantages, electric chimneys also have some limitations. It's important to consider these factors before making a decision:

Disadvantages

Limited heating capacity compared to other types of chimneys

Dependent on electricity, so power outages can affect their functionality

Lack of a real flame may not provide the same ambience as a traditional fireplace

May not be suitable for large spaces requiring significant heat output

While electric chimneys may not provide the same level of heat and ambiance as traditional fireplaces, they offer a convenient and low-maintenance option for homeowners.

Ventless or Ethanol Fireplaces

Ventless or ethanol fireplaces are a unique type of chimney that offers a modern and eco-friendly alternative to traditional wood-burning fireplaces. These fireplaces operate without a chimney or venting system and are fueled by ethanol, a renewable and clean-burning biofuel.

Construction and Materials

Ventless or ethanol fireplaces are typically designed as freestanding units or wall-mounted fixtures. They are constructed using high-quality materials such as stainless steel, tempered glass, and heat-resistant ceramics. The combustion chamber, where the ethanol fuel is burned, is often enclosed in a glass casing to provide a clear view of the flames.

The fuel for ventless fireplaces is ethanol, which is derived from plant sources such as sugarcane and corn. Ethanol burns cleanly and efficiently, producing a real flame without the need for wood or gas. The fireplaces are equipped with burners that allow for easy ignition and flame control.

Advantages and Disadvantages

Ventless or ethanol fireplaces offer several advantages compared to traditional chimneys:

Advantages

  1. No chimney or venting required: Ventless fireplaces eliminate the need for a chimney or venting system, making them easier to install in various locations within a home or building.
  2. Clean and eco-friendly: Ethanol is a renewable and clean-burning fuel that produces minimal emissions. Unlike wood-burning fireplaces, ventless fireplaces do not release harmful smoke, ash, or soot into the air.
  3. Easy to use and maintain: Ventless fireplaces are user-friendly and require minimal maintenance. They can be easily ignited, controlled, and extinguished using a built-in control mechanism. Cleaning is also simplified, as there are no ashes or soot to remove.
  4. Efficient heating: Ethanol fireplaces provide efficient heat output, allowing for effective zone heating in smaller spaces. They can quickly warm up a room, providing a cozy and comfortable ambiance.

Disadvantages

  1. Limited heat output: While ventless fireplaces provide sufficient heat for smaller areas, they may not be as effective in heating larger spaces or whole houses.
  2. Dependence on fuel availability: Ethanol fuel needs to be purchased separately and may not be as readily available as other fuel sources. It's important to ensure a sufficient supply of fuel for uninterrupted use.
  3. Lack of traditional fireplace ambiance: Ventless fireplaces do not provide the same crackling sound and wood-burning scent as traditional fireplaces. Some individuals may miss the nostalgic ambiance associated with wood-burning fires.
